Cross-Chain Liquidity Aggregation: Unlocking Global Financial Efficiency

In the rapidly evolving world of decentralized finance (DeFi), one of the most critical challenges facing users is the limited cross-chain interoperability. DeFi applications are spread across various blockchains—each with its own rules, token standards, and liquidity pools. This fragmentation limits the user experience, as users must navigate between different platforms to access the desired financial services. Cross-Chain Liquidity Aggregation (XCLA) is a solution that aims to address this issue by aggregating liquidity from multiple chains into a single, seamless interface for users.

Understanding XCLA

Cross-chain liquidity aggregation refers to the process of consolidating liquidity across different blockchains through smart contracts or decentralized applications (DApps). These aggregators act as intermediaries, allowing users and DeFi protocols to access broader pools of assets without needing direct interoperability between chains. The key benefits of XCLA include:

1. Simplified User Experience: Users can trade across multiple tokens and blockchains with a single DApp or interface, eliminating the need for complex interactions between different blockchain platforms.

2. Enhanced Liquidity Access: Aggregators ensure that users can access liquidity from various chains without having to switch protocols or navigate complex cross-chain transactions.

3. Increased Efficiency: By consolidating liquidity, XCLA reduces gas fees and transaction times across multiple chains, making DeFi more accessible and efficient for a broader user base.

Technology Behind XCLA

XCLA relies on several technologies to function effectively:

Smart Contracts and Decentralized Applications (DApps)

The backbone of XCLA is the smart contracts that facilitate cross-chain transactions. These contracts are designed with predefined rules for sending assets from one chain to another, using various cryptographic techniques like hash functions and digital signatures to ensure security and authenticity. DApps built on top of these contracts provide a user-friendly interface for interacting with the aggregated liquidity pool.

Chainlink as an Oracles Solution

Accurate price information is crucial in DeFi, especially when dealing with cross-chain transactions. Chainlink serves as an oracle solution by providing secure and reliable data feeds that are used to determine asset values across different chains. This ensures that users can accurately swap between tokens without the risk of significant value loss due to mispricing.

Layer 2 Solutions and Rollups

To handle the growing demand for scalability without compromising decentralization or security, layer 2 solutions like Optimistic Rollups have emerged. These solutions move some of the Ethereum's transactions off-chain while still allowing users to interact with them as if they were happening on-chain. XCLA can integrate these layer 2 solutions to further enhance efficiency and reduce gas costs across chains.

Challenges and Future Directions

While XCLA promises a more interconnected DeFi ecosystem, it faces several challenges:

1. Security Risks: Aggregating liquidity from multiple sources increases the attack surface for hackers. Ensuring robust security measures is paramount to protect users' assets and maintain trust in the system.

2. Data Integrity: Maintaining accurate and consistent data across chains can be complex, especially considering the diverse nature of blockchain protocols. Oracles like Chainlink play a crucial role here, but continuous improvements are necessary.

3. Privacy Concerns: Users need to trust that their private information is handled securely when using XCLA services. Ensuring privacy and compliance with regulatory requirements is an ongoing challenge.

4. Scalability: As the number of chains and users grows, scalability concerns become more pressing. Integrating layer 2 solutions and optimizing cross-chain transactions are critical to maintaining efficiency.
